										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Taipei Veterans General Hospital (<strong>TVGH</strong>) inaugurated its heavy ion therapy facility on May 15 this year, completing treatment for 100 patients within six months as of today (Dec. 5). TVGH Superintendent Chen Wei-ming noted that pancreatic cancer—previously considered untreatable—can now be <a class="tag" href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/%E6%A6%AE%E7%B8%BD" rel="榮總 noopener" data-rel="/2/125945" target="_blank"></a><a class="tag" href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/%E6%89%8B%E8%A1%93" rel="手術 noopener" data-rel="/2/128034" target="_blank"><strong>surgically</strong> </a>removed following chemotherapy and heavy ion therapy. Other conditions, including prostate, lung, liver, bone and soft tissue sarcoma, head and neck, and gynecological cancers, have also been successfully treated.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Taipei Veterans General Hospital (TVGH) held a Thanksgiving Ceremony today to mark two major clinical milestones: achieving 100 heavy ion therapy cases and completing 5,000 Robotic-Assisted Da Vinci surgeries. The event also featured a ribbon-cutting ceremony for Taiwan’s first high-tech negative-pressure ICU and the launch of the &#8220;TVGH No. 1 Cloud&#8221; supercomputer. Veterans Affairs Council Minister Feng Shih-kuan attended the event, commending the TVGH team led by Superintendent Chen Wei-ming for their exceptional achievements in <a class="tag" href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/%E7%99%8C%E7%97%87%E6%B2%BB%E7%99%82" rel="癌症治療 noopener" data-rel="/2/125248" target="_blank">cancer treatment</a>, critical care epidemic prevention, and smart healthcare to benefit patients. He encouraged the entire TVGH healthcare system to continue working together to deliver high-quality medical services.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>&#8220;A patient&#8217;s life is priceless. Seeing critically ill patients recover makes everything worth it,&#8221; said Chen Wei-ming. He noted that Taipei Veterans General Hospital (TVGH) built the heavy ion therapy center despite the operational losses it would incur. Currently, the treatment process is proceeding smoothly, with patients making good recoveries and their long-term outcomes being continuously monitored. With many candidates still on the waiting list, the operating center has drawn a steady stream of visiting delegations from around the world.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Chen Wei-ming also expressed his gratitude to the entire TVGH staff for their unit, solidarity, and collaborative efforts in presenting these remarkable achievements at the end of the year. Beyond heavy ion therapy, Taipei Veterans General Hospital (TVGH) has completed 5,000 robotic-assisted Da Vinci surgeries, including challenging cancer procedures such as pancreatic cancer, periampullary cancer, and partial nephrectomy for renal cancer. Currently, TVGH holds the highest case volume nationwide for Da Vinci procedures in these three conditions. Furthermore, the broader Veterans Affairs Council healthcare system has collectively performed nearly 12,000 Da Vinci surgeries.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Today also saw the inauguration of &#8220;TVGH No. 1 Cloud&#8221;—Taiwan’s first clustered supercomputing platform custom-designed for a hospital. Powered by next-generation AI processing capabilities, a robust data center, and innovative computing architecture, the platform aims to advance medical applications of generative AI and Large Language Models (LLMs).</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>&#8220;TVGH No. 1 Cloud&#8221; significantly enhances overall computing capacity, accelerating the hospital&#8217;s progress in precision medicine, smart healthcare, disease prognosis prediction, genomic sequence analysis, digital pathology precision diagnosis, and AI-driven drug discovery. Furthermore, it serves as an optimal development platform for AI applications.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Chen Wei-ming noted that this not only enhances diagnostic precision but also accelerates the formulation of personalized treatment strategies for various diseases. This marks not only a major milestone in TVGH’s IT development, but also a significant step forward for Taiwan in high-performance computational medicine. Furthermore, it opens new avenues for international medical collaboration, further driving innovation and development in medical AI.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>In response to future emerging infectious diseases, Taiwan&#8217;s first smart-tech Intensive Care Unit (ICU) has been launched at Taipei Veterans General Hospital (TVGH). TVGH invested over NT$100 million to construct 15 smart negative-pressure isolation ICU beds in its Technology Building, which is structurally separated from the main inpatient buildings to ensure compartmentalization. The facility integrates cutting-edge and self-developed technologies—including an AI smart mirror for PPE donning and doffing guidance and a hand hygiene monitoring system—which have earned recognition from the National Healthcare Quality Award. Additionally, satellite nursing stations facilitate remote image monitoring and ventilator adjustments, while smart TVs and three-way video communication systems are installed. Robots are also deployed to assist nurses with supply transport, minimizing infection exposure risks for medical personnel.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>During epidemic outbreaks, this facility provides negative-pressure isolation intensive care under the highest infection control standards; during normal operations, it functions as a respiratory intensive care unit for general critical care. This approach achieves five key objectives: &#8220;blocking the virus, transmitting signals out, delivering medical care in, connecting care partners, and keeping family members visually connected&#8221;—thereby significantly enhancing the quality of critical care. Furthermore, multiple advanced technological innovations, including smart robots, elevate both care quality and infection control safety.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Taipei Veterans General Hospital launched its heavy ion therapy service on May 15 this year, completing treatment for 100 patients within six months as of today (12/5). According to stats from the hospital, the top four cancers treated with heavy ion therapy over the past six months are <a href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/榮總" data-rel="/2/125945" target="_blank" rel="noopener"></a><a href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/攝護腺癌" data-rel="/2/104861" target="_blank" rel="noopener">prostate cancer</a>, pancreatic cancer, liver cancer, and lung cancer—with prostate and pancreatic cancers each accounting for one-third of cases, and pancreatic cancer showing the best results. The current approach for treating pancreatic cancer combines heavy ion therapy with chemotherapy, offering patients who were originally unsuitable for surgery a chance to shrink their tumors enough for surgical resection.</p>
<p>Li Wei-chiang, Vice President of Taipei Veterans General Hospital, noted that because the pancreas is located deep within the body, pancreatic cancer is difficult to detect early and is often diagnosed at Stage IV. At this stage, the tumor has typically adhered to surrounding blood vessels and tissues, rendering surgery impossible. Furthermore, conventional radiation therapy can easily cause complications, making treatment exceptionally difficult, ineffective, and associated with a high mortality rate.</p>
<p>Taipei Veterans General Hospital established the &#8220;Pancreatic Cancer Treatment and Research Center&#8221; in August this year. Li Wei-chiang pointed out that current pancreatic cancer treatment utilizes heavy ion therapy combined with chemotherapy, which has successfully detached tumors from surrounding blood vessels and tissues in several patients to facilitate subsequent surgery. Multiple<a href="https://udn.com/search/tagging/2/患者" data-rel="/2/133652"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><strong> patients</strong> </a>have already received treatment, with Li stating, &#8220;This is what brings me the greatest joy.&#8221;</p>
<p>Currently, the number of pancreatic cancer patients receiving heavy ion therapy at Taipei Veterans General Hospital ranks second, behind only prostate cancer. When Japanese experts visited Taipei VGH recently and learned about these pancreatic cancer treatment outcomes, they were deeply impressed.</p>
<p>Li Wei-chiang noted that many cancer patients view heavy ion therapy as their last ray of hope, with a significant number being referred from other hospitals. In response, Taipei VGH has added special outpatient clinics to evaluate patients&#8217; conditions as quickly as possible. Heavy ion therapy at Taipei VGH requires a varying number of treatment sessions per course depending on the type of cancer—for instance, pancreatic cancer and prostate cancer each require 12 sessions. Each full treatment course costs approximately NT$1 million to NT$1.5 million out-of-pocket, and most patients are over 60 years old.</p>
<p>Heavy ion therapy is an out-of-pocket treatment. For cancer patients who do not meet the treatment criteria, the hospital strictly screens candidates and refers them to relevant departments for appropriate care, preventing patients from spending money unnecessarily on unsuitable therapy. Li Wei-chiang noted that many breast cancer patients visit the heavy ion outpatient clinic seeking treatment; however, since effective medications covered by National Health Insurance are currently available for breast cancer, the hospital declines these requests even if patients are willing to pay out-of-pocket, as patient well-being must come first.</p>
<p>Li Wei-chiang noted that heavy ion therapy is costly and recalled that at the time of its opening in May, the hospital pledged to reserve 2% of its capacity annually to treat underprivileged patients free of charge. Currently, one eligible candidate from a disadvantaged background has submitted an application. A meeting will be held this Friday to review the patient&#8217;s medical condition and evaluate whether heavy ion therapy is suitable. As a public hospital, Taipei VGH remains committed to fulfilling its promise and upholding its responsibility to care for public health.</p>

<h3><span style="color: #ff9900;">RevoCart Surgery Services</span></h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<h6><span style="color: #ff9900;"><strong>Description:</strong></span></h6>
<ul>
<li>RevoCart surgery service is a minimally invasive procedure that utilizes autologous cartilage processed through physical and chemical treatment to activate chondrocytes, combined with a bioresorbable biphasic scaffold (mimicking cartilage and subchondral bone).</li>
<li>Implanted via arthroscopy or a minimally invasive incision, it enables cartilage regeneration and repair. The procedure takes approximately 1 to 2 hours, and patients can typically be discharged 1 to 2 days post-surgery.</li>
<li>The RevoCart team conducted clinical trials in Taiwan, with its efficacy and safety certified by the Ministry of Health and Welfare (MOHW). Follow-up data spanning approximately ten years demonstrates that post-operative joint pain is significantly relieved, quality of life is enhanced, and patient satisfaction remains high.</li>
</ul>
<h6><strong><span style="color: #ff9900;">Features:</span></strong></h6>
<ul>
<li>Single-stage, minimally invasive procedure with small incisions.</li>
<li>Regenerated cartilage is structurally similar to native cartilage.</li>
<li>Extends the lifespan of your natural joint.</li>
<li>Allows a return to high-intensity sports and exercise after recovery.</li>
</ul>
<h6><span style="color: #ff9900;"><strong>Symptoms:</strong></span></h6>
<ul>
<li>* Pain caused by cartilage and subchondral bone defects.</li>
<li>Early-stage osteoarthritis (without severe mechanical axis alignment deviation).</li>
</ul>
<h6><span style="color: #ff9900;">Target Area:</span></h6>
<ul>
<li>knee</li>
<li>Talus</li>
</ul>
<h6><strong><span style="color: #ff9900;">Rehabilitation Services:</span></strong></h6>
<ul>
<li>Post-operative rehabilitation is required.</li>
<li>Initially practice partial weight-bearing post-surgery, gradually increasing weight load as pain subsides. Use of a knee brace and assistive devices is recommended, alongside joint range-of-motion stretching exercises to stimulate cartilage regeneration and repair.</li>

<h4 dir="auto">Loss of Appetite Turn Out to Be Pancreatic Cancer: Concurrent Proton and Chemotherapy Achieves a Turnaround!</h4>
<div dir="auto">In October last year, 57-year-old Ms. Chen suffered from a loss of appetite, losing nearly 10 kilograms within three months. After seeking medical attention at Taipei Veterans General Hospital, she was diagnosed with Stage III pancreatic cancer. However, because the tumor had already invaded major blood vessels, it could not be surgically removed. She then visited the Proton and Radiation Therapy Center at Linkou Chang Gung Memorial Hospital for a consultation to see if proton therapy could provide further treatment options.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">During her consultation at the Department of Radiation Oncology with Director Chang Tung-Chieh, Ms. Chen and her family learned—thanks to Director Chang’s warm and professional explanation—that besides surgical treatment, pancreatic cancer can also be treated with concurrent chemoradiotherapy (concurrent radiation therapy and chemotherapy). However, conventional radiation therapy (photon therapy) is limited by its energy penetration depth, causing significant damage to the gastrointestinal tract. As a result, the radiation dose cannot be increased during conventional chemoradiotherapy, and chemotherapy often has to be halted due to side effects, making it difficult to achieve optimal efficacy. In contrast, proton therapy can lower the dose delivered to the gastrointestinal tract and reduce side effects, allowing a higher radiation dose to be delivered directly to the tumor for better therapeutic outcomes than conventional photon therapy. Consequently, Ms. Chen and her family decided to undergo concurrent proton therapy combined with chemotherapy.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Translation:<br />During the approximately one-and-a-half-month course of concurrent proton therapy and chemotherapy, Ms. Chen did not experience severe diarrhea or the need to halt treatment—issues commonly seen with conventional therapy. She had only mild diarrhea, which did not affect her overall nutritional status. As a result, the chemotherapy administered concurrently with proton therapy proceeded according to the original plan without any dose reductions or interruptions. Ms. Chen was also able to continue receiving consolidation chemotherapy following the concurrent proton and chemotherapy treatment, ultimately achieving the desired optimal therapeutic outcome.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Three months after completing proton therapy, Ms. Chen underwent a PET scan to evaluate the tumor&#8217;s response to treatment. The results showed complete local control with no metabolic activity detected. Subsequent CT scans revealed that the original tumor had shrunk from 4 cm to approximately 2 cm, indicating a favorable response and suggesting that the remaining mass is very likely residual scar tissue post-treatment. She will continue to be monitored closely.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Proton radiation therapy has brought hope for a cure to pancreatic cancer patients whose tumors were previously considered inoperable and left doctors with limited options. Utilizing the latest proton radiation therapy enables patients to achieve pain-free treatment, superior efficacy, and fewer side effects, thereby reversing their condition. In the future, we hope more patients can stage a successful comeback just like Ms. Chen!</div>

<h4 dir="auto">Inner Mongolia Man Finds New Life Through Proton Therapy After Post-Surgery Lung Cancer Metastasis</h4>
<div dir="auto">Just when a patient believes they have escaped the threat of death after undergoing difficult surgery, realizing that the disease is still lingering comes as the biggest shock. This situation is often the most agonizing for both the patient and the family supporting them through the ordeal.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Mr. Tang (pseudonym), a man in his 50s from Inner Mongolia, was once a typical optimistic nomad of the grasslands, blessed with a bold, clear, resonant voice and a bright, hearty smile. However, after being diagnosed with lung cancer during an examination in February 2016 and undergoing surgical resection, his originally bold and clear voice vanished completely, replaced by a raspy, low-pitched guttural sound that sent his spirits plummeting to rock bottom. Yet troubles came in succession—shortly after, his local doctor delivered another piece of bad news: the tumor site appeared not to have been cleanly excised, posing a risk of further spread and metastasis. Having barely survived the grueling surgery to save his life, Mr. Tang was immediately confronted with the fact that his life remained under threat; this double blow left him deeply despondent, looking utterly crestfallen and frail, which weighed heavily on his worried family.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">After continuous searching for treatment options and consultations, Mr. Tang and his family decided a month later to fly nearly 2,000 kilometers to Taiwan&#8217;s Chang Gung Memorial Hospital for a comprehensive examination. Following a series of tests, including a bronchoscopy and CT scans, Dr. Kuo Han-pin from Chang Gung&#8217;s Division of Pulmonary and Critical Care Medicine evaluated that residual tumor tissue and partial metastasis were indeed present. However, because it had only been a short month since Mr. Tang&#8217;s surgery, and his post-operative hoarseness was quite severe, Dr. Kuo proceeded with utmost caution, concluding that chemotherapy combined with proton therapy should be administered first to stabilize his condition in order to achieve the best medical outcome.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to"></div>
<div dir="auto">In recent years, the development and application of proton therapy in cancer treatment have been rapidly expanding. The Proton and Radiation Therapy Center at Chang Gung Memorial Hospital opened in 2015, making it the largest proton therapy center in Asia. Its biggest difference compared to conventional photon therapy—the radiation therapy currently used by most hospitals—lies in the strong penetrative nature of photon beams, which are more likely to damage normal tissue behind the tumor site. In contrast to traditional radiation therapy using X-rays, proton therapy allows precise energy control, releasing a massive amount of energy at a specific depth while releasing minimal energy along its pathway. Furthermore, charged particles have a fixed depth of penetration, leaving zero radiation beyond the tumor area and drastically reducing damage to healthy surrounding tissue. For patients whose tumors are unsuitable for surgical removal, proton therapy lowers treatment risks, reduces distant radiation dosage, and significantly minimizes side effects, enabling patients to maintain a good quality of life throughout their course of treatment.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">After deciding to receive treatment at Chang Gung Memorial Hospital, Mr. Tang traveled from Mongolia to Taiwan again in May 2016, undergoing a total of three weeks of chemotherapy and 12 sessions of proton therapy before returning to Inner Mongolia once his condition was confirmed to be stable. Half a year later, he returned to Taiwan&#8217;s Chang Gung Memorial Hospital for a follow-up examination. Follow-up CT scans confirmed that there was no tumor recurrence, though an inflammatory reaction was present at the site of the primary tumor. The medical team evaluated that the inflammation was a normal post-proton-therapy reaction and no cause for overconcern. They advised Mr. Tang to pay attention to daily self-care, including eating slowly and chewing thoroughly rather than taking large bites, as well as maintaining regular exercise and continuing his pulmonary medications, after which he would only need to return for routine follow-up checkups at scheduled intervals.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">For patients with relatively advanced lung cancer that has not yet metastasized to distant sites, combined chemotherapy and radiation therapy currently offers the best therapeutic outcomes. Because larger tumors are often accompanied by lung collapse, which severely impacts a patient&#8217;s physical condition and quality of life, proton therapy can minimize radiation damage to the remaining lung tissue and preserve maximal lung function. Learning that his cancerous lesions had been successfully cleared left Mr. Tang with a deep appreciation for the precise diagnosis and high-standard care at Taiwan&#8217;s Chang Gung Memorial Hospital. Reflecting on his three medical trips to Taiwan, he shared that he was not only impressed by the hospital&#8217;s advanced facilities but also felt completely at ease throughout the process. Now, he and his family no longer live under a cloud of worry, thanks to the dedicated efforts of Dr. Kuo Han-pin and the medical team. Moving forward, he will continue regular follow-up checkups and focus on daily self-care in hopes of making a full recovery soon, wishing to sing freely once again on the vast grasslands.</div>

<div dir="auto"><span style="font-size: 16px;">Xiao Chen (pseudonym), a 35-year-old male and a prominent lawyer from Malaysia, traveled to Taiwan for nasopharyngeal carcinoma treatment. Facing a second recurrence of nasopharyngeal carcinoma, he was cautious. Through online searches and extensive inquiries, he learned that Taiwan has vast experience treating nasopharyngeal carcinoma patients, rendering it almost as routine as managing a common cold. Furthermore, our hospital possesses proton therapy machines, a facility available in only a few Asian countries. Xiao Chen then provided our hospital with his relevant medical reports from his first nasopharyngeal carcinoma treatment in Malaysia—including pathology slides, whole-body PET scans, and initial photon therapy records. Accompanied by his wife and filled with hope, he traveled across the ocean to Taiwan Chang Gung Memorial Hospital seeking proton therapy.</span></div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Upon Xiao Chen&#8217;s arrival in Taiwan, our center immediately arranged outpatient consultations and relevant examinations with his specified physicians, Dr. Chang Tung-Chieh and chemotherapy specialist Dr. Hsieh Chia-Hsun. Following the recommendations of both physicians, Xiao Chen underwent a whole-body PET scan and blood tests once again to serve as baseline indicators for his proton therapy and chemotherapy. Dr. Chang Tung-Chieh, with an approachable and humorous tone, explained the re-irradiation treatment plan to Xiao Chen and his wife, who appeared strong on the surface. Dr. Chang recommended a combined regimen of 33 proton therapy sessions and 33 photon therapy sessions, paired with weekly chemotherapy concurrent with radiation therapy to achieve disease control. During the course of treatment, Xiao Chen experienced almost none of the skin discomfort typically caused by prolonged radiation exposure, which greatly surprised him. Based on his previous experience with photon therapy in Malaysia, severe radiation dermatitis at the irradiated site was quite common.</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">As his treatment in Taiwan drew to a close, the tumor on the inner side of Xiao Chen&#8217;s neck gradually shrank. By simply maintaining a normal daily routine and acquiring proper knowledge regarding medication, Xiao Chen will only need to monitor post-radiation side effects—including regular dental follow-ups—after returning to his home country. With a treatment outcome like this, who can say that a cancer recurrence is an incurable disease?</div>
</div>
<div class="x11i5rnm xat24cr x1mh8g0r x1vvkbs xtlvy1s x126k92a">
<div dir="auto">Proton radiation therapy is currently the world’s most advanced technique for tumor radiotherapy. Compared to conventional radiation therapy, proton radiation therapy causes significantly less damage to healthy cells surrounding the lesion site, resulting in fewer side effects. Many highly treatable tumors can achieve high cure rates through proton therapy (either alone or combined with surgery and chemotherapy). Beyond improving quality of life both during and after treatment, proton therapy also reduces the risk of developing secondary malignancies caused by the &#8220;low-to-moderate radiation doses&#8221; delivered to normal tissues in conventional radiotherapy.</div>
